This is Max's update from his family :love5:

Thought I would let you know how Max is getting on in his new home. At night he has been fantastic - just a little grumble after we shut the kitchen door, but he soon stopped and then slept all night !! (that grumble only happened on the first and second night as he didn't think it was time for bed) He must have been shattered on Saturday as he hardly had any sleep, with the weather being so good he spent most of his day playing in the garden and as he had alot to do, so he didn't fancy any sleep. He made up for it on Sunday!
Over the weekend it feels like I just said no all the time.(Not just to Max but the kids as well) He was into everything. He has:-

chased chickens
tried to play with the cat
tried to figure out how to meet the rabbits and gunea pig
and, of course, found the pond

He is ace though and is beginning to understand that not all the animals around here want to play with him so eagerly. A more gentle approach allows him to get nearer to say hello - a little bit of work to do with the cat as she isn't comfortable just yet; she watches from above and carefully considers what on earth her best friend is doing with a puppy standing by her side!!.
At first we thought Molly (our spaniel) was a little jealous and had the odd grumble at Max when he bounced virtually on top of her. Now we think that she was a little unsure of what was happening and felt a little bit nervous. So not to force things we put two beds side by side. Its worked as they now share one bed and seem very happy and comfortable with each other.
Max is ace and it seems that he just loves company, especially human. He likes to be close by. (He is now asleep under the computer desk). As to his training, he is definately learning as we go. There are encouraging signs that he will soon put his chicken worrying days behind him.
